Aijun Ye is a scholar working on Civil and Structural Engineering, Building and Construction and Public Health, Environmental and Occupational Health. According to data from OpenAlex, Aijun Ye has authored 80 papers receiving a total of 2.0k indexed citations (citations by other indexed papers that have themselves been cited), including 55 papers in Civil and Structural Engineering, 12 papers in Building and Construction and 6 papers in Public Health, Environmental and Occupational Health. Recurrent topics in Aijun Ye's work include Seismic Performance and Analysis (42 papers), Geotechnical Engineering and Underground Structures (28 papers) and Geotechnical Engineering and Soil Mechanics (15 papers). Aijun Ye is often cited by papers focused on Seismic Performance and Analysis (42 papers), Geotechnical Engineering and Underground Structures (28 papers) and Geotechnical Engineering and Soil Mechanics (15 papers). Aijun Ye collaborates with scholars based in China, United States and Canada. Aijun Ye's co-authors include Xiaowei Wang, Lianxu Zhou, Abdollah Shafieezadeh, Enrique F. Schisterman, Bohai Ji, Sunni L. Mumford, Jean Wactawski‐Wende, Xing Shen, Jochen Autschbach and Cuilin Zhang and has published in prestigious journals such as Nature Communications, The Journal of Chemical Physics and American Journal of Clinical Nutrition.
